1972 Mercury Comet vs. 1953 Porsche 1300

To start off, 1972 Mercury Comet is newer by 19 year(s). Which means there will be less support and parts availability for 1953 Porsche 1300. In addition, the cost of maintenance, including insurance, on 1953 Porsche 1300 would be higher. At 2,782 cc (6 cylinders), 1972 Mercury Comet is equipped with a bigger engine. In terms of performance, 1972 Mercury Comet (81 HP @ 4400 RPM) has 22 more horse power than 1953 Porsche 1300. (59 HP @ 5500 RPM). In normal driving conditions, 1972 Mercury Comet should accelerate faster than 1953 Porsche 1300. With that said, vehicle weight also plays an important factor in acceleration. 1972 Mercury Comet weights approximately 374 kg more than 1953 Porsche 1300. So despite on having greater horse power, its additional weight may have an impact towards its acceleration in comparison.

Both vehicles are rear wheel drive (RWD) - it offers better handling in dry conditions; in addition, if you are looking to drift, both vehicles do the job better than front wheel drive vehicles.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1972 Mercury Comet (175 Nm @ 1800 RPM) has 87 more torque (in Nm) than 1953 Porsche 1300. (88 Nm @ 3600 RPM). This means 1972 Mercury Comet will have an easier job in driving up hills or pulling heavy equipment than 1953 Porsche 1300.

Compare all specifications:

1972 Mercury Comet 1953 Porsche 1300
Make Mercury Porsche
Model Comet 1300
Year Released 1972 1953
Engine Position Front Rear
Engine Size 2782 cc 1290 cc
Engine Cylinders 6 cylinders 4 cylinders
Engine Type in-line boxer
Horse Power 81 HP 59 HP
Engine RPM 4400 RPM 5500 RPM
Torque 175 Nm 88 Nm
Torque RPM 1800 RPM 3600 RPM
Drive Type Rear Rear
Vehicle Weight 1224 kg 850 kg
Vehicle Length 4620 mm 3960 mm
Vehicle Width 1800 mm 1680 mm
Vehicle Height 1350 mm 1300 mm
Wheelbase Size 2630 mm 2110 mm
